SUMMARY This incumbent is responsible for reviewing and analyzing physicians’ documentation and assigns, CPT, Modifiers and ICD-10 diagnosis codes. The coding function also ensures compliance with established coding guidelines, third party reimbursement policies, regulations, and accreditation guidelines.



Job Duties & Essential Functions

  • Provide a variety of complex and technical assignments related to physician surgical coding.
  • Analyze, code and abstract information for the purpose of assigning and entering appropriate and consistent diagnoses and procedure codes and Modifiers for reimbursement.
  • Obtain Pathology Reports from Power Chart when applicable.
  • Enter information into the database.
  • Correct TES and Claim Scrubber Edits.
  • Resolve discrepancies on coding related issues.
  • Perform all other duties as assigned by management.


Required Qualifications

  • High School diploma/GED.
  • Current Certified Coding Specialist (CCS) Certification, CCS-P or Certified Professional Coder (CPC) Certification.
  • 1 year of physician surgical coding experience.
  • Must be proficient in Microsoft Office Word and Excel.


Preferred Qualifications

  • Associate’s Degree.
  • 3 years of physician surgical coding experience.

Staff Co is a Professional Employer Organization, commonly referred to as a PEO, duly organized and registered under the New York Professional Employer Organization law. Staff Co and SUNY have entered into a professional employer agreement under which Staff Co is the employer of Stony Brook Clinical Practice Management Plan employees and responsible for all aspects of employment, including hirings, promotions, disciplines, terminations, the day-to-day direction and supervision of work, as well as labor relations and collective bargaining.

Staff Co is fully responsible for providing all payroll and human resources services, including the payment of wages, collecting and reporting payroll taxes and maintaining any and all employee benefits.
